🧪 High-Yield Named Reactions

1. Reimer-Tiemann Reaction

Reactants: Phenol + Chloroform (CHCl₃) + aq. NaOH

Product: Salicylaldehyde (o-hydroxybenzaldehyde)

Key intermediate: Dichlorocarbene (:CClâ‚‚)

2. Cannizzaro Reaction

Condition: Aldehydes with NO alpha-hydrogen (e.g., Formaldehyde, Benzaldehyde)

Reagent: Conc. Alkali (NaOH/KOH)

Type: Disproportionation (Self-oxidation and reduction)

3. Wurtz Reaction

Reactants: Alkyl halide + Sodium (Na)

Condition: Dry Ether

Result: Alkanes with double the number of carbon atoms (symmetrical alkanes).
